Brooklyn-based pop-punk outfit QWAM have unveiled a gripping lyric video for their latest single, “About You.” Co-directed by filmmaker Francesca Pazniokas and the band’s own lead vocalist Felicia Lobo, the video pairs gritty visuals with the band’s trademark emotional punch and cathartic hooks.
The track is the latest preview from QWAM’s forthcoming album girls aren’t afraid of blood, due out August 1. With its driving rhythms, snarling guitars, and raw vocal delivery, “About You” showcases their knack for blending vulnerability with fury, highlighting their growing strength within the indie and punk rock underground.
